
the youth group
Since we are a small church, we have a small youth group. However, we
are always looking to reach out to new youth in the community. For the
most part, the youth group tries to do some type of small inexpensive activity
to enjoy themselves every other month or so.
Roller-skating, bowling, and putt-putt are examples of activities that might
take place on a weeknight or a weekend.
The biggest activity of the year for the youth group though is Youth Day.
This occurs once a year at CGC. Rick & Darlene Minshew are in charge of
our youth group. They do an excellent job at getting prepared for the big
day.
On Youth Day, which is always a Saturday, the church is opened up for fun
activities for the youth and adults. It's like a small carnival for free
to the public. We make hotdogs, buy chips and drinks and serve everyone
halfway through the day. There are games in different rooms of the church,
a cake walk, face painting, a clown, and all activities win a prize.
Several times throughout the day, the praise band also performs. It is a
great day of indoor and outdoor fun!!
